    Ingredients in Banana Pie Recipe

    Homemade Pie Crust

    • Flour - you can use all-purpose flour for this recipe.
    • Salt - any kind of sea salt or finely ground salt will work.
    • Crisco - crisco works great because it doesn’t melt as easily as butter.  But, you can absolutely substitute cold butter if you’d prefer.
    • Water - use super cold water to keep the dough as cool as possible.  You can even add ice cubes to the water (just don’t add the ice cubes into the dough).
    • Egg Wash and Sugar - applying an egg wash to the dough gives it a little shine and keeps the crust nice and crisp.  You don’t need much - just an egg and a tablespoon of water.  We like to finish off with a sprinkle of sugar, too.

    Banana Cream Filling

    • Bananas - try and find bananas that are ripe, but not mushy.
    • Sugar - this recipe calls for regular granulated sugar.
    • Cornstarch - this helps to thicken the custard filling.
    • Salt
    • Milk - use either whole milk or 2% milk for this recipe.
    • Egg Yolks - for best results, use fresh eggs rather than the yolks from the carton and save the whites for another use.
    • Butter - this will melt best if you cut it into chunks.
    • Vanilla Extract - pure vanilla extract tastes best.

    Homemade Whipped Cream

    • Heavy Whipping Cream - for the sturdiest whipped cream, make sure your heavy cream is super cold before trying to whip.
    • Powdered Sugar - any kind of powdered sugar will work.
    • Vanilla Extract - pure vanilla extract tastes best.

    How to Make Homemade Banana Cream Pie

    1. Make the pie dough.  See our post on Homemade Flaky Pie Crust for detailed instructions on how to mix, roll and shape your own dough.  
    2. Line the pie dish.  Carefully line a pie plate with the rolled dough then fold the edges under and pinch the edges of the dough to make a decorative edge.  Prick the edges and bottom of the pie crust with a fork, about 2 inches apart.
    3. Blind bake the crust.  Line with parchment paper or aluminum foil and fill with ceramic pie beads or dry beans.  Bake the prepared pie crust in a preheated 425 degree oven for about 12 minutes, or until lightly golden on the edges. Remove from the oven and let cool while you make the filling.
    4. Make the banana cream filling.  In a large pot, combine the sugar, cornstarch, and salt and whisk together.  Pour in the cold milk and egg yolks, then whisk again until smooth.  Turn heat on to medium high and whisk while the milk mixture comes to a boil.  Continue to stir at a boil for 1 minute, or until the filling is thick and bubbly then remove from heat and add the butter and vanilla extract, stirring until the butter has melted.
    5. Fill the pie shell.  Slice bananas into ½" pieces and lay them in the bottom of the pie crust in an even layer.  Pour the warm mixture over the bananas, into the prepared pie crust, smoothing the top of the pie with a knife or off-set spatula.
    6. Chill then serve.  Lay a sheet of plastic wrap on top of the pie and let it come to room temperature before transferring to the fridge to cool for up to 24 hours.  Top or serve with homemade whipped cream, or cool whip and enjoy!

    Variations

    • Chocolate Banana Cream Pie: stir in 8 ounces of finely chopped semisweet chocolate when you are adding the butter to the pie filling and continue to stir until it has completely melted.
    • Banana Coconut Cream Pie: use coconut milk instead of plain milk in your filling and top with toasted coconut flakes.
    • No-Bake Banana Cream Pie: instead of this homemade pie crust, pour the filling and bananas into our Nilla Wafer Crust, Graham Cracker Crust or this Gingersnap Crust.
    • Banana Ginger Cream Pie: fold chopped crystallized ginger into the homemade whipped cream.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can I make this pie ahead of time?

    You have a few different options if you want to make this pie ahead of time.  First, you can always pre-make and bake the pie crust and store at room temperature overnight or even in the freezer for up to 2 months.

    You can also make the filling the day before and keep it in an airtight container in the fridge.  The next day, give it a good whisk before pouring it into your pre-baked pie shell lined with bananas.

    Can this be made into a No-Bake Banana Cream Pie?

    Yes!  You can make any one of our no-bake pie crusts and fill with this banana cream filling.  Some of our favorites include Nilla Wafer Pie Crust, Graham Cracker Pie Crust and this Gingersnap Pie Crust.  

    Can you freeze Banana Cream Pie?

    Sure!  If you want to freeze it, we recommend that you do not top it with whipped cream.  Wrap it well in plastic wrap and aluminum foil, then store for up to 1 month.  Once you are ready to serve, pull out to room temperature for a few hours and make your homemade whipped cream just before serving.

    Best Banana Cream Pie Recipe

    This Banana Cream Pie uses our homemade flaky pie crust and fills it with fresh bananas and the most creamy, dreamy banana cream filling.  Topped with freshly whipped cream, this classic dessert is absolutely heavenly.
    Course Dessert
    Cuisine American
    Prep Time 30 minutes
    Cook Time 15 minutes
    Total Time 45 minutes
    Servings 1 9-inch pie
    Calories 581kcal
    Author The Carefree Kitchen

    Ingredients

    Single Pie Crust Recipe

    • 1 ¼ cups All-Purpose Flour
    • ½ teaspoon Salt
    • 4 oz Crisco or butter
    • ¼ cup Water cold

    Banana Cream Pie Filling

    • ¾ cup Sugar
    • 4 Tablespoons Cornstarch
    • ½ teaspoon Salt
    • 2 cups Milk
    • 3 large Egg Yolks
    • 3 Tablespoons Butter
    •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
    • 2 large Ripe Bananas

    Homemade Whipped Cream

    • 1 ½ Cups Heavy Whipping Cream
    • ¼ cup Powdered Sugar
    •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ract

    Instructions

    Basic Double Pie Crust

    • Preheat oven to 425 degrees.
    • In a large mixing bowl, combine the four and salt.
    • Add the Crisco (or cold butter) and use your fingers to combine. Once the mixture resembles coarse meal, make a well in the center and add the water.
    • Carefully bring the flour mixture from the sides of the bowl into the center with the water and gently mix until combined and the flour is all moistened. Do not overmix or knead!
    • Form the dough into a flat disc, wrap in plastic and let rest in the cooler for about 30 minutes - 1 hour. Note: if you don’t have time, don’t worry about chilling the dough.  It’s a good practice, but not 100% necessary with this recipe.
    • Once the dough has rested, remove from the plastic wrap and transfer to a lightly floured surface. Use a rolling pin, start in the middle of the dough and roll outwards to make a circle. Roll into an evenly thick round circle large enough for the dough to hang over your pie plate at least ½".
    • Carefully line a pie plate with the rolled dough then fold the edges under and pinch the edges of the dough to make a decorative edge. Prick the edges and bottom of the pie crust with a fork, about 2 inches apart, then line with parchment paper or aluminum foil and fill with ceramic pie beads or dry beans.
    • Bake the prepared pie crust in a preheated 425 degree oven for about 12 minutes, or until lightly golden on the edges. Remove from the oven and let cool while you make the filling.

    Banana Cream Pie Filling

    • In a large pot, combine the sugar, cornstarch, and salt and whisk together. Pour in the cold milk and egg yolks, then whisk again until smooth.
    • Turn heat on to medium high and whisk while the milk mixture comes to a boil. Continue to stir at a boil for 1 minute, or until the filling is thick and bubbly then remove from heat and add the butter and vanilla extract, stirring until the butter has melted.
    • Slice bananas into ½" pieces and lay them in the bottom of the pie crust in an even layer. Transfer the pie filling to the prepared pie crust, smoothing the top of the pie with a knife or off-set spatula.
    • Lay a sheet of plastic wrap on top of the pie and let it come to room temperature before transferring to the fridge to cool for up to 24 hours.
    • Top or serve with homemade whipped cream, and enjoy!

    Homemade Whipped Cream

    • In a large chilled bowl using a handheld mixer, or a stand mixer with the whisk attachment, add the cold heavy whipped cream, powdered sugar and vanilla extract.  
    • Whip the heavy cream mixture on medium high speed for about 3-4 minutes, or until stiff peaks form.
    • Use immediately, or cover with plastic wrap and chill for up to 24 hours. Enjoy!
